The CIO of Ranmore Funds isn’t too keen on U.S. valuations at present, but the beaten-down software sector is luring him back in.

Reported by 1 outlet MarketWatch. See all sources ↓

A global equity fund earned a 150% return over five years for its investors. The fund holds only a small number of U.S. stocks. Its chief investment officer says current U.S. stock prices are too high. However, he sees value in the software sector, which has fallen in price.

Why it matters

It shows that investors can get strong returns by looking beyond the U.S. market. It also highlights caution about high U.S. valuations and opportunities in beaten‑down tech stocks.
